Crucial Overview to Commercial Septic Repair Work

Dealing with septic systems is a vital element of keeping commercial buildings, particularly in country or suburbs where metropolitan sewer system are unavailable. Business septic tanks are commonly larger and more complicated than property systems, putting a premium on regular upkeep and prompt repair work. Understanding the essential components and common problems associated with commercial septic repair service can aid entrepreneur stop pricey downtime and carcinogen.

One of the most vital factors in preserving an industrial septic tank is routine inspection and maintenance. Gradually, solids can gather in the septic tank, bring about blockages and ultimate failure if not dealt with quickly. It’s recommended to have an expert conduct assessments and pump the tank every three to 5 years, depending upon usage. This aggressive method not only extends the life of the system however likewise makes sure conformity with neighborhood laws.

When it pertains to repairs, determining the signs of a failing septic tank is essential. Typical indications include slow drainage, unpleasant smells, and the presence of sewer back-ups. If any one of these problems develop, it’s crucial to contact a specialist septic repair work service immediately to evaluate the scenario. Delaying repair work not just intensifies the problem but can additionally bring about substantial residential or commercial property damages and enhanced repair work expenses.

Purchasing specialist septic fixing solutions can conserve commercial homeowner money and time in the future. Experienced service technicians can successfully identify problems and carry out corrective steps, such as replacing damaged elements or upgrading the system for much better efficiency. Furthermore, depending on seasoned professionals guarantees that repair services abide by health and wellness division policies, thus reducing the threat of fines or legal action.

Grease Catch Cleaning: Importance and Ideal Practices

Oil catches are crucial components in industrial cooking areas and food service facilities, created to capture fats, oils, and oil (FOG) before they get in the wastewater system. Over time, if not correctly maintained, these traps can end up being blocked, leading to obstructions, unpleasant smells, and even costly plumbing problems. Normal oil trap cleaning is vital to make sure conformity with regulations and maintain the performance of drainage systems.

The procedure of grease trap cleansing includes several steps, including inspection, removal of built up waste, and extensive cleaning. First of all, it is essential to examine the oil catch to determine how much buildup has happened. Once assessed, the next action is to pump out the trapped grease and solids, generally utilizing specialized vacuum tools. After pumping, the grease catch need to be junked and cleaned to get rid of remaining deposits that could create future blockages.

Along with keeping pipes health, regular grease catch cleansing promotes a much more hygienic cooking area atmosphere. A tidy oil trap lessens the danger of insects, foul odors, and the potential for grease-related fires. For companies, this not only safeguards the physical assets however likewise boosts the total customer experience, guaranteeing that restaurants are not subjected to unpleasant smells or sights. Moreover, if a cooking area is found to have improperly preserved oil traps, it can encounter penalties from local health and wellness departments.

Scheduling routine cleaning is essential, and frequency may vary based upon the quantity of food prepared. While some facilities could just require a tidy every couple of months, an active restaurant may require to keep a regular monthly cleansing timetable. Some businesses pick to work with professional grease catch company to ensure compliance and correct upkeep, easing personnel from this time-consuming job. Investing in professional services can save costs in the long run as it helps to stay clear of prospective plumbing problems and fines.

The Art of Unloading and Stockpiling: A Comprehensive Guide to Efficient Supply Chain Management

Effective supply chain management is crucial for businesses to maintain a competitive edge in today’s fast-paced market. One of the key components of a well-managed supply chain is the ability to unload and stockpile goods efficiently. Unloading and stockpiling refer to the process of receiving and storing goods in a warehouse or storage facility, and it requires careful planning and execution to ensure that goods are handled safely, efficiently, and cost-effectively.

1. Understanding the Importance of Unloading and Stockpiling

Unloading and stockpiling are critical steps in the supply chain process, as they directly impact the speed and accuracy of order fulfillment. When goods are unloaded and stored properly, they are less likely to be damaged or lost, which reduces the risk of stockouts and overstocking. Additionally, efficient unloading and stockpiling processes enable businesses to respond quickly to changes in demand, which is essential in today’s dynamic market.

2. Preparing for Unloading and Stockpiling

Before unloading and stockpiling goods, businesses must prepare their warehouses and storage facilities to ensure that they can handle the volume and type of goods being received. This includes inspecting the warehouse for any damage or defects, cleaning and maintaining the storage areas, and ensuring that all necessary equipment and tools are available. Businesses must also develop a clear plan for unloading and stockpiling, including the use of specialized equipment, such as forklifts and pallet jacks, and the allocation of personnel to oversee the process.

3. Unloading Goods Safely and Efficiently

Unloading goods safely and efficiently requires careful planning and execution. Businesses must ensure that all goods are properly secured and protected during transportation to prevent damage or loss. Upon arrival, goods must be unloaded quickly and safely, using specialized equipment and personnel as needed. This includes inspecting goods for damage or defects, and documenting any issues or discrepancies.

4. Stockpiling Goods Effectively

Once goods have been unloaded, they must be stockpiled effectively to ensure that they are easily accessible and can be retrieved quickly when needed. This includes organizing goods into designated storage areas, using clear labeling and signage to identify the location and contents of each storage area, and maintaining a clean and organized warehouse environment. Businesses must also develop a system for tracking and monitoring inventory levels, to ensure that goods are not overstocked or understocked.

5. Managing Inventory Levels

Managing inventory levels is critical to ensuring that goods are not overstocked or understocked. Businesses must develop a system for tracking and monitoring inventory levels, including the use of inventory management software and regular physical counts. This enables businesses to identify trends and patterns in demand, and make informed decisions about inventory levels and stockpiling.

6. Minimizing Stockouts and Overstocking

Stockouts and overstocking are two of the most common inventory management challenges faced by businesses. Stockouts occur when goods are not available to meet customer demand, while overstocking occurs when goods are stored in excess of demand. Businesses can minimize the risk of stockouts and overstocking by developing a clear understanding of demand patterns and trends, and adjusting inventory levels accordingly.

7. Implementing a First-In, First-Out (FIFO) System

Implementing a first-in, first-out (FIFO) system is an effective way to manage inventory levels and minimize the risk of stockouts and overstocking. In a FIFO system, the oldest goods are sold or used first, which ensures that goods are not stored for extended periods of time and reduces the risk of spoilage or obsolescence.

8. Using Technology to Streamline Unloading and Stockpiling

Technology can play a critical role in streamlining unloading and stockpiling processes. Businesses can use inventory management software to track and monitor inventory levels, and automate the process of receiving and storing goods. This includes using barcode scanners and RFID tags to track goods as they are received and stored, and using automated storage and retrieval systems (AS/RS) to retrieve goods quickly and efficiently.

9. Training and Development

Training and development are critical components of effective unloading and stockpiling processes. Businesses must ensure that all personnel involved in unloading and stockpiling are properly trained and equipped to handle the task safely and efficiently. This includes providing training on the use of specialized equipment, such as forklifts and pallet jacks, and developing a clear understanding of inventory management principles and practices.

10. Continuous Improvement

Continuous improvement is essential to ensuring that unloading and stockpiling processes are efficient and effective. Businesses must regularly review and evaluate their unloading and stockpiling processes to identify areas for improvement, and implement changes and adjustments as needed. This includes monitoring inventory levels and demand patterns, and adjusting inventory levels and stockpiling strategies accordingly.

High Voltage Switch: What To Know

High voltage switches are critical components in electrical power systems, responsible for interrupting or diverting electrical current in high-voltage circuits. These switches play a vital role in ensuring the safe and efficient operation of power grids, protecting equipment from damage, and maintaining system reliability. Understanding the principles, types, and applications of high voltage switches is essential for electrical engineers, technicians, and anyone involved in the design, operation, and maintenance of electrical power systems.
One of the primary functions of a high voltage switch is to isolate faulty equipment or sections of the power system. When a fault occurs, such as a short circuit or insulation failure, the switch quickly disconnects the affected area, preventing the fault from spreading and causing further damage. This isolation capability is crucial for maintaining the overall stability and integrity of the power grid. High voltage switches also enable the safe maintenance and repair of electrical equipment. By isolating the equipment from the energized system, workers can perform necessary tasks without the risk of electric shock or arc flash.
There are several types of high voltage switches, each designed for specific applications and operating conditions. Circuit breakers are perhaps the most common type, used to interrupt fault currents and protect equipment from overloads and short circuits. Circuit breakers typically employ various extinguishing media, such as oil, gas (SF6), vacuum, or air, to quench the arc that forms when the contacts separate. Disconnect switches, also known as isolators, are used to isolate equipment for maintenance or to create a visible break in the circuit. These switches are not designed to interrupt fault currents and must be opened only after the circuit has been de-energized by a circuit breaker. Load break switches are designed to interrupt normal load currents, but they have limited fault interrupting capability. They are often used in distribution systems to switch loads on and off or to transfer loads between different circuits.
The selection of a high voltage switch depends on several factors, including the voltage and current rating of the system, the interrupting capacity required, the operating environment, and the application. Voltage and current ratings must be carefully matched to the system requirements to ensure that the switch can handle the expected electrical stresses. Interrupting capacity, which is the maximum fault current that the switch can safely interrupt, is another critical parameter. The operating environment, including temperature, humidity, and altitude, can also affect the performance of the switch. For example, switches installed in harsh environments may require special enclosures or insulation to protect them from corrosion or contamination. The specific application, such as transmission, distribution, or industrial power systems, will also influence the choice of switch.
